Difference between revisions of "Implementing Devolved Constraints"

From MyWiki
Jump to: navigation, search
Line 24: Line 24:
 
|Test the database connection using Java class
 
|Test the database connection using Java class
 
|Done for test db [[ Example java code here ]]  
 
|Done for test db [[ Example java code here ]]  
 +
|-
 
|Test the connection to live db
 
|Test the connection to live db
 
|In progress
 
|In progress
 
|}
 
|}

Revision as of 11:49, 5 February 2018

  • Download the jdbc connector for Microsoft SQL Server

The oldish version of java on the server might cause a compatibility issue as the java version is 6 :
see https://docs.microsoft.com/en-us/sql/connect/jdbc/system-requirements-for-the-jdbc-driver
Requires a Java Runtime Environment (JRE) 7.0. Using JRE 6.0 or lower will throw an exception.
Looks like we need version 4 of the jdbc connector : https://docs.microsoft.com/en-us/sql/connect/jdbc/microsoft-jdbc-driver-for-sql-server-support-matrix#java-and-jdbc-specification-support
But it looks like it's no longer available "We're sorry, this download is no longer available."
Managed to download from here : http://www.mediafire.com/file/3ycmaelhoot/sqljdbc4.jar

  • Test the connection to the target database using a simple java app
  • Install the connector in the "lib" folder in the Tomcat Shibboleth application
  • Modify the CLASSPATH variable to include the connector
  • Perform a re-install of Shibboleth using the install script
  • Edit the Shibboleth config files

Useful link - https://wiki.shibboleth.net/confluence/display/SHIB2/ResolverRDBMSDataConnector

Project Progress
Task Status
Source the jdbc connector Done
Test the database connection using Java class Done for test db Example java code here
Test the connection to live db In progress